Exa Webhooks & Events
Overview
Build event-driven integrations around Exa neural search. Exa is a synchronous search API (no native webhooks), so this skill covers building async patterns: scheduled content monitoring with searchAndContents, similarity alerts with findSimilarAndContents, new content detection using date filters, and webhook-style notification delivery.
Prerequisites
exa-js installed and EXA_API_KEY configured
Queue system (BullMQ/Redis) or cron scheduler
Webhook endpoint for notifications
Event Patterns
Pattern Mechanism Use Case Content monitor Scheduled searchAndContents with startPublishedDate
Similarity alert Periodic findSimilarAndContents + diff Competitive monitoring
Content change Re-search + compare result sets Update tracking
Research digest Scheduled answer + email/Slack Daily briefings
Instructions
Step 1: Content Monitor Service import Exa from "exa-js";
import { Queue, Worker } from "bullmq";
const exa = new Exa(process.env.EXA_API_KEY!);
interface SearchMonitor {
id: string;
query: string;
webhookUrl: string;
lastResultUrls: Set<string>;
intervalMinutes: number;
searchType: "auto" | "neural" | "keyword";
}
const monitorQueue = new Queue("exa-monitors", {
connection: { host: "localhost", port: 6379 },
});
async function createMonitor(config: Omit<SearchMonitor, "lastResultUrls">) {
await monitorQueue.add("check-search", config, {
repeat: { every: config.intervalMinutes * 60 * 1000 },
jobId: config.id,
});
console.log(`Monitor created: ${config.id} (every ${config.intervalMinutes} min)`);
}
Step 2: Execute Monitored Searches const worker = new Worker("exa-monitors", async (job) => {
const monitor = job.data;
// Search for new content published since last check
const results = await exa.searchAndContents(monitor.query, {
type: monitor.searchType || "auto",
numResults: 10,
text: { maxCharacters: 500 },
highlights: { maxCharacters: 300, query: monitor.query },
// Only find content published in the monitoring window
startPublishedDate: getLastCheckDate(monitor.id),
});
// Filter to genuinely new results
const newResults = results.results.filter(
r => !monitor.lastResultUrls?.has(r.url)
);
if (newResults.length > 0) {
await sendWebhook(monitor.webhookUrl, {
event: "exa.new_results",
monitorId: monitor.id,
query: monitor.query,
timestamp: new Date().toISOString(),
results: newResults.map(r => ({
title: r.title,
url: r.url,
snippet: r.text?.substring(0, 200),
highlights: r.highlights,
publishedDate: r.publishedDate,
score: r.score,
})),
});
// Update tracked URLs
await updateLastResultUrls(monitor.id, newResults.map(r => r.url));
}
}, { connection: { host: "localhost", port: 6379 } });
Step 3: Similarity Alert System async function monitorSimilarContent(
seedUrl: string,
webhookUrl: string,
checkIntervalHours = 24
) {
const results = await exa.findSimilarAndContents(seedUrl, {
numResults: 5,
text: { maxCharacters: 300 },
excludeSourceDomain: true,
// Only find content from the last check period
startPublishedDate: new Date(
Date.now() - checkIntervalHours * 60 * 60 * 1000
).toISOString(),
});
if (results.results.length > 0) {
await sendWebhook(webhookUrl, {
event: "exa.similar_content_found",
seedUrl,
matchCount: results.results.length,
matches: results.results.map(r => ({
title: r.title,
url: r.url,
snippet: r.text?.substring(0, 200),
score: r.score,
})),
});
}
return results.results.length;
}
Step 4: Webhook Delivery with Retry async function sendWebhook(url: string, payload: any, maxRetries = 3) {
for (let attempt = 0; attempt < maxRetries; attempt++) {
try {
const response = await fetch(url, {
method: "POST",
headers: {
"Content-Type": "application/json",
"X-Exa-Event": payload.event,
},
body: JSON.stringify(payload),
});
if (response.ok) return;
console.warn(`Webhook ${response.status}: ${url}`);
} catch (error) {
if (attempt === maxRetries - 1) throw error;
}
await new Promise(r => setTimeout(r, 1000 * Math.pow(2, attempt)));
}
}
Step 5: Daily Research Digest async function generateDailyDigest(
topics: string[],
webhookUrl: string
) {
const digest = [];
for (const topic of topics) {
const results = await exa.searchAndContents(topic, {
type: "neural",
numResults: 3,
summary: { query: `Latest developments in: ${topic}` },
startPublishedDate: new Date(
Date.now() - 24 * 60 * 60 * 1000
).toISOString(),
});
digest.push({
topic,
articles: results.results.map(r => ({
title: r.title,
url: r.url,
summary: r.summary,
})),
});
}
await sendWebhook(webhookUrl, {
event: "exa.daily_digest",
date: new Date().toISOString().split("T")[0],
topics: digest,
});
}
Error Handling Issue Cause Solution Rate limited monitors Too many concurrent checks Stagger monitor intervals Empty results Date filter too narrow Widen to 48-hour windows Duplicate alerts Missing URL dedup Track result URLs between runs Webhook delivery fails Endpoint down Retry with exponential backoff
Examples
Create a Competitive Intelligence Monitor await createMonitor({
id: "competitor-watch",
query: "AI code review tools launch announcement",
webhookUrl: "https://api.myapp.com/webhooks/exa-alerts",
intervalMinutes: 60,
searchType: "neural",
});
